Police protest outside coalition parties’ HQ
Police unionists were on Thursday protesting outside the headquarters of the three political parties involved in Greece’s coalition government, New Democracy, PASOK and Democratic Left, Skai reported.
An unknown number of riot police were deployed to intervene if necessary, the report said.
Police are protesting anticipated cuts to their salaries and benefits.
Tens of thousands of Greeks marched through central Athens on Wednesday in the first general strike since the conservative-led coalition was formed in June, as the prime minister and finance minister hammered out a package of 11.5 billion euros in spending cuts demanded by the troika of foreign lenders.
